Castle offering a guest room and two gites in Saussignac.
Caroline - a certified winemaker and wine trainer - and Sean Feely moved from Ireland to settle on 10 hectares at Château Haut-Garrigue in an organic vineyard overlooking the Dordogne valley. They decided to open up their estate to visitors, creating a guest room and two fully-equipped gîtes, luxuriously furnished and ecologically built from wood, with breathtaking views over the valley. They organize half-day and full-day wine tastings, discovery meals and even the possibility of creating our own blends.
